Output 6f625a2a05a127a24f9b50d6b278594d4c8bde15e75680b7de76d8e581e6923f:0

value
103656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210621d620194f085402d565ca7ef7035b38d5e6 OP_EQUAL
address
34hdZwmPHMD6YsNxpNbqnzVBwspDqyfDVz
transaction
6f625a2a05a127a24f9b50d6b278594d4c8bde15e75680b7de76d8e581e6923f
spent
true